Step 1: Designing Your Cap in Canva

The first step in creating your custom cap is designing it in Canva. Here’s how:

  1. Choose the Right Canvas Size – Fourthwall requires specific measurements for cap designs. Set your Canva dimensions accordingly.
  2. Create a High-Quality Design – Use bold colors, eye-catching fonts, and simple yet impactful graphics. Your design should be clear even when embroidered.
  3. Download Your Design – Save it in high resolution (preferably PNG) for the best results.

Step 2: Enhancing Your Design with Leonardo AI

Once your base design is ready, take it to the next level using Leonardo AI:

  1. Upload Your Canva Design – Leonardo AI offers an advanced “Flow State” option, generating multiple variations of your design.
  2. Refine and Select – Pick from the AI-generated options, ensuring spelling and details are accurate.
  3. Download the Final Version – Save your polished design for the next step.

Step 3: Uploading to Fourthwall & Customizing Your Cap

Now that you have a professional-quality design, it’s time to put it on a cap:

  1. Log into Fourthwall – Choose the cap style you want to customize.
  2. Upload Your Design – Fit it into the designated embroidery space.
  3. Customize Embroidery Colors – You can select up to six colors for the front and up to four for the sides and back.
  4. Preview Your Cap – Make sure the colors and placement look perfect before finalizing.
  5. Set Pricing & Publish – Choose competitive pricing and launch your custom cap!
